Ungated normal space.
Tip: Warp to 100km and lead the initial group out to 150 to 175km range. Keep at least 30km range from the 7 Corpus battleships (Neut). Destroy the 2 Dark Corpus Harbinger Battleships last to trigger spawn.
Blitz: Put the NOH Signal Operator into the container and return to the agent. For fast delivery you can create a bounce BM as you land, warp to the bounce BM and then warp to an asteroid near the container.
